The Highland Spring HIHO in the Caribbean will be one of the most amazing SUP events this summer. What is it? The Highland Spring HIHO event originated in St Thomas in 1979 when a band of intrepid windsurfers set out to sail through the Virgin Islands with sleeping bags on their backs.

The event was an immediate hit and grew exponentially under sponsorship from Johnnie Walker Scotch Whiskey.  Under the current event owner Andy Morrell the Highland Spring HIHO event grew even bigger and now is the World’s most fun-filled  and unique watersports adventure as it charts a course through Caribbean Islands. So far it was for sailing and windsurfing, but this year it will also  include SUP Racing. It takes place in the British Virgin Islands, a cluster of around 60 islands, that were an El Dorado for pirates in former times, with their hidden and unaccounted bays,  perfect to hide and wait for the Spanish ships in transit, loaded to the brim with gold from the new world.

There will be SUP races every day including a 1-day prize-money leg scheduled for the Friday, July 6th:
The Soggy Dollar Challenge will pit racers on a 12-mile downwind sprint from Trellis Bay on Tortola’s East end to White Bay, Jost Van Dyke.   Teams of three racers will compete using the same board.  The course is, simply, straight downwind with a finish at the famed Soggy Dollar Beach Bar.
Stand up paddle manufacturer Fanatic joins the 2012 event as the official SUP sponsor and the event will include a Fanatic One-Design Class and an Open Class for SUP racers.
In addition to the races, daily activities are available for non-race participants including kayaking, snorkeling, scuba diving (for an additional fee), yacht racing, fishing, beach trips and a treasure hunt.  Highland Spring HIHO is also well know for fine cuisine and live entertainment with excellent dinners planned for each island stop and nightly Caribbean entertainment and dancing.
“SUP continues to become an exciting portion of the event,” said event organizer Andy Morrell.  “The two sports perfectly complement each other.  We are excited to have racers & participants from all over the World attend the event.” Rates for the Highland Springs HIHO 2012 begin at $2,099 per person for a double cabin occupancy aboard a 40’ or 43’ catamaran and include lunch and dinner with drinks, all parties, most activities, taxes (except a $20.00 airport departure tax) and an official HIHO T-shirt and bag or hat.  Additional options are available including an air-conditioned 46’ catamaran upgrade, single cabin supplement, junior participation rate and Kids 6 years and Under rate.  Race fees are $125.00 per racer for competing stand up paddlers and windsurfers. “The HIHO is truly the ultimate Windsurfing and SUP destination vacation,” explained John Denney, Owner of Jupiter Paddleboarding.  “First class, family friendly, and run with the highest level of professionalism.  My wife Bari and I recommend this to anyone and everyone for a vacation of a lifetime, you only live once.”
Fanatic as official SUP supplier
Fanatic will be the official SUP supplier of the HIHO Highland Spring race in the BVI this summer, July 1st-8th! The new Fanatic Ray 12’ will be the board in the new Fanatic One Design class and the event will include a Fanatic One-Design Class and an Open Class for SUP racers. Limited edition custom graphics featuring the event sponsor logos will be incorporated into the board design. The Ray is an ideal board
for a week of island-to-island down-wind paddling through the BVI’s.
“Joining this renowned event is great,” said Fanatic boss Craig Gertenbach. “We are excited to participate and plan to send some of our Fanatic team to race. The Ray is the perfect board for the fun conditions and spirit of the HIHO, offering stability, speed and comfort in one great package” The official product launching date of the Ray will be July 15th, so details on the board will follow later in the year.
Fanatic International riders like 2011 14´0 World Champion Chase Kosterlitz, Belar Diaz and Kirsty Jones will all attend the event, to compete in the open and team classes, adding a great competitive aspect to the event too!
